What is a Funded Forex Trading Account?

A funded Forex trading account is a type of account that provides traders with the opportunity to trade in the foreign exchange market without risking their own money. Instead, the account is funded by an investment company, giving the trader access to their capital. In many cases, the investment firm will provide an initial deposit for a chosen trader, as well as any funds needed for future trades.

The aim of these types of accounts is to encourage traders to improve their trading skills and make profitable trades. Achieving success and consistent profitability could lead to an increase in the funds provided for the trader, allowing them to trade larger position sizes and over more extended periods.

How Does a Funded Forex Trading Account Work?

The process of obtaining a funded Forex trading account is relatively straightforward. A trader must typically pass certain tests or evaluations to demonstrate their trading skills and ability to make a profit. After passing these tests, the investment company agrees to provide the trader with the necessary funds to start trading with.

It is worth noting that the investment firm will take a cut of any profits generated, usually within a range of 10-30%. These fees could act as an incentive for traders to work even harder to make successful trades and achieve their financial goals.

What Are the Benefits of a Funded Forex Trading Account?

For traders who are starting in Forex trading, the benefits of a funded Forex trading account are clear. For one, they provide an opportunity to get started in trading with no need to raise capital. This can help new traders avoid the risks and obstacles associated with self-funded Forex trading.

Additionally, these types of accounts often come with other forms of support, such as ongoing training and educational resources. This can help new traders improve their skills and become confident in their ability to make profitable trades.

What Are the Potential Drawbacks of a Funded Forex Trading Account?

Whilst there are many potential benefits to using a funded Forex trading account, there are also some potential drawbacks that traders should be aware of.

One of these drawbacks is that investment firms typically require traders to meet their trading targets within certain time frames. For some traders, this can add additional pressure and stress, potentially leading to overtrading or making poor trading decisions.

Another potential disadvantage is that some investment companies have strict rules and regulations that traders must follow. This can include limits on trading instruments, position sizing, and other trading strategies. Traders who are used to using more complex trading strategies may find it challenging to adjust to these limitations.

Finally, as we mentioned earlier, investment firms will typically profit from the success of traders, taking a cut of any profits generated. Whilst the fees are usually reasonable, some traders may feel that the percentage is too high, affecting their ability to achieve their financial goals.

How to Choose a Funded Forex Trading Account Provider

Choosing a funded Forex trading account provider requires careful consideration, as the right provider can dramatically impact a trader's success.

When searching for a provider, it's essential to research their reputation and track record carefully. Check to see if they have a history of providing support to successful traders and if their success rate is high. Reading reviews from other traders can also be helpful in gaining insight into the provider's strengths and weaknesses.

Another essential factor to consider is the types of services and resources that the provider offers. Do they offer ongoing training and development opportunities to help you improve your trading skills? Do they provide access to a range of trading tools and products, such as automated trading systems or educational courses?

Finally, it's worth considering any fees or commissions charged by the provider. The ideal provider will offer reasonable fees that will allow you to keep a significant portion of the profits generated from trading.
